Description of Job

This position assists Facilities Services personnel with performance of their duties with aspecial emphasis on strenuous general labor tasks. This will include but not be limited to: custodial cleaning office and construction moves special events set-ups and take-downs recycling orders grounds/nursery deliveries and conferences.

Other duties performed by this position include:

  • Assist set-up for indoor/outdoor special and athletic events.
  • Assist with scheduled moves within the campus community Moving offices around after construction projects or remodels.
  • Clean campus facilities before during and after indoor/outdoor special and athletic events
  • Perform project deep cleaning
  • Assists ground/nursery crew by shoveling raking. Lifting carrying pushing pulling and/or other means with various tasks including snow removal and plowing.
  • Small equipment repair
  • Maintenance of recycling bins and material
  • Light painting
  • Light and ballast repairs
  • Pressure washing and window cleaning of buildings
  • Performing general custodial duties.
  • Operate machinery.
  • Must be willing to perform work duties while exposed to extremes in weather elements (i.e. snow in the winter heat in the summer).
  • This position must understand SDS Sheets proper use of cleaning chemicals water naturalsoaps synthetic detergents/surfactants solvents acid alkaline cleaners etc. The use of these chemicals requires proper safety precautions and knowledge of various chemical hazards.

** This position is required to work flexible schedules including split shifts weekends and evenings to provide adequate coverage as needed.

In this position you will be required to exert or lift in excess of 100 lbs. of force occasionally and/or in excess of 50 lbs. of force frequently and/or in excess of 20 lbs. for force constantly. It also requires constant or frequent climbing stooping kneeling crouching crawling handling pushing pulling and reaching.

Appeal Rights: (Updated)

An applicant who has been removed from an employment list or removed from consideration during the selection process may request a review by the State Personnel Director.

As an applicant directly affected by the results of the selection or comparative analysis process you may file a written appeal with the State Personnel Director.

Review of the completed signed and submitted appeal will be timely on the basis of written material submitted by you using the official appeal form signed by you or your representative. This form must be completed and delivered to the State Personnel Board by email atwithin ten (10) calendar days from your receipt of notice or acknowledgement of the Departments action.


For further information on the Board Rules you can refer to 4 Colorado Code of Regulations (CCR) 801-1 State Personnel Board Rules and Personnel Directors Administrative Procedures Chapter 8 Resolution of Appeals and Disputes at Information
